Foot swelling, or edema, occurs when excess fluid accumulates in the tissues of the feet, leading to an increase in size and a feeling of fullness or tightness. This condition can be localized to the feet or extend to the ankles and legs. Swelling can result from a variety of causes, ranging from benign to more serious underlying conditions. Common causes include prolonged standing or sitting, which can impair circulation and lead to fluid retention. Injuries such as sprains or fractures can also cause localized swelling due to inflammation. Medical conditions like heart failure, where the heart is unable to pump blood effectively, or kidney disease, which can affect fluid balance, can lead to generalized edema. Other causes include venous insufficiency, where weakened veins in the legs fail to return blood efficiently to the heart, and certain medications, such as those for hypertension or diabetes, which can cause fluid retention as a side effect.
Treatment for foot swelling depends on its underlying cause. For mild, non-medical causes, such as standing for long periods, elevating the feet, reducing salt intake, and engaging in regular physical activity can help manage and reduce swelling. Applying cold compresses to the affected area may also provide relief. For more persistent or severe swelling, addressing the underlying medical condition is crucial. In cases related to heart failure or kidney disease, managing the primary condition with medications, dietary changes, and lifestyle modifications can be essential. Compression stockings may be recommended for venous insufficiency to improve blood flow and reduce swelling. If swelling is associated with an injury, rest, ice, compression, and elevation (R.I.C.E) are standard initial treatments. Consulting a healthcare provider is important for a thorough evaluation to determine the exact cause of swelling and to receive appropriate and effective treatment.
